Creative hands-on activities to help students learn and review important math concepts through games, holiday fun, projects and children's literature. Included are lists of materials needed and clear directions for each activity as well as the skills students will learn or practice by doing the activity. Skills covered include: addition and subtraction, measuring, estimating, graphing and much more.

Brenda Kaufmann graduated from Iowa State University with a degree in elementary education in 1992. She has taught second grade in Iowa for 11 years. When not teaching or writing, she enjoys spending time with her family and three large dogs, reading, long-distance running, playing the piano, listening to music and enjoying the beautiful Iowa outdoors.
